Australia Day – Survival Day

Mount Alexander Shire Council is proud that we host a joint Australia Day–Survival Day event on 26 January each year, where we welcome new Australian citizens and announce winners of the Mount Alexander Shire Australia Day Awards.

Australia Day–Survival Day event 2025

Council extends a big thank you to residents for taking part in our Australia Day - Survival Day 2025 community event.

The day included a moving Welcome to Country by Dja Dja Wurrung Elder Uncle Rick Nelson, a citizenship and awards ceremony, a Survival Day concert, and catering courtesy of local businesses.

Congratulations to our 2025 Australia Day Award winners

Citizen of the Year – Rachel Stewart
Young Citizen of the Year – Thea Sydes
Senior Citizen of the Year – Trish Bowles
Event of the Year – Castlemaine Idyll 2024

2024 Australia Day Award winners

We are proud to announce the recipients of the 2024 Australia Day Awards:

Citizen on the Year – Debbie Hamilton
Young Citizen of the Year – Claire Mitchell
Senior Citizen of the Year – Barb Templar
Community Event of the Year – Taradale Mineral Springs Festival
